An age old statement goes like, ‘We don’t appreciate the creator, but we will cherish in his creation’, and it looks like that is coming into reality yet again. Those who had criticized Pawan Kalyan for his doings are now hailing this man who happens to be his find.
Apparently when the title song from Bheemla Nayak, singer Kinnera Mogulaiha has shot to fame instantly, not because of the song, but also due to the fact that he was featured in the lyrical video of the song too. During that time, some came down heavily on Pawan for making a folk singer go all the way to Chennai to sing, and also to act in the song just for the sake of bringing promotions to his film.
And now, when Mogulaiha was conferred with Padmasri, many politicians, police officers and other bureaucrats are hailing him. Pawan Kalyan’s fans are right now doing a rampage on social media saying that those bureaucrats who called Pawan Kalyan just as a film star but nothing else are now hailing his find as a gem. “Maybe PK is just a movie star, but there is none like him when it comes to talent spotting”, a fan commented.
Of course, it is undeniable that Mogulaiha is an original talent, but then all this fame and recognition has come only because he has featured in Bheemla Nayak. If not, today none would be talking about him for sure. “So next time you want to get attention of governments, awards and bureaucrats, then try to feature in a Pawan Kalyan’s song or film” another fan posted.
